Output f63791798fbca241717d0eee786bf515c510c2acfeb71decfd0d363166cb5a0a:0

value
42195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a76df24aa730240224e4e3aefd68b5488315e4b OP_EQUAL
address
39wM99zD6Mze6s8XSV6xhm1L3JRgdsw1zu
transaction
f63791798fbca241717d0eee786bf515c510c2acfeb71decfd0d363166cb5a0a
confirmations
252204
spent
true